Where to eat in Minneapolis
Tenant
4300 Bryant Ave S, Minneapolis, MN 55409
This snug and rustic eatery offers deliciously simple food without the fuss. Their seasonal menu consists of six set courses that rotate regularly to provide guests with a fresh, innovative take on New American cuisine. Whether you’ll sample the seafood salad, stacked braised lamb or seasonal soups all depends on when you decide to visit.
Spoon and Stable
211 N 1st St, Minneapolis, MN 55401
This converted carriage house houses a hip-yet-cozy dining room that offers the very best of French-Italian-inspired food. Their seasonal menu features everything from oysters to hearty tortellini and wagyu steak. For dessert, try delicate caramelized peaches and cream, or go all-out with their blackberry and chocolate gateau.
Alma
528 University Ave SE, Minneapolis, MN 55414
Located north of the Mississippi River in Marcy-Holmes, the intimate surroundings perfectly suit the fine-dining menu at Alma. Seasonal menus vary with a la carte and set three-course ordering options, with dishes including the likes of duck liver bruschetta, octopus tempura and pan seared sturgeon.
What to see and do in Minneapolis
Minneapolis Institute of Art
2400 3rd Ave S, Minneapolis, MN 55404
Just a 15-minute drive away from Minneapolis Airport and minutes from its surrounding hotel districts, the Minneapolis Institute of Art is home to over 90,000 international works of art. It’s an amazing place to explore world culture and you can walk through 20,000 years of history – from the ancient Arts of Africa all the way up to more contemporary pieces.
The Mall of America
60 E Broadway, Bloomington, MN 55425
Just south of MSP Airport in the South Loop District is the Mall of America. As its name suggests, it’s the largest shopping mall in the country. Browse more than 500 stores, ride one of the rollercoasters in the Nickelodeon Universe theme park and say hello to underwater creatures at the SEA LIFE Minnesota Aquarium – all without leaving the mall.
Mill City Museum
704 S 2nd St, Minneapolis, MN 55401
Once the largest flour mill in the world on the banks of the Mississippi in downtown East, learn about Minneapolis’ industrial history at Mill City Museum. It offers an exciting, interactive experience for all ages, with railroad cars, cooking demonstrations and interesting equipment on display. On weekends, there’s the bonus of a farmers’ market in the train shed, with around 40 vendors selling coffee, donuts, jewelry and clothing.
